Close modal
当前位置:首页 > 幼教培训 > 特聘专家论文集锦 > 牛顿插值算法在因式分解中的设计与实现

牛顿插值算法在因式分解中的设计与实现

时间:2017-01-11 12:26:23

计算机出现以后,研究多项式因式分解的构造和算法实现问题成为计算机代数的重要课题,对此国内外很多学者做了大量的工作,吴文俊教授在文献[2]中作了系统详细的研究,给出因式分解方法,A.K.Lenstra,H.K.Lenstra和L.Lova’sz三人于1982年首次提出了一元整系数多项式分解算法[3],即著名的L3算法。
本文基于Kronecker因式分解的基本思想[4]:在有理数域内,任何n次多项式都能经有限此算术运算分解为不可约多项式的乘积。设f(x)为整系数多项式且f(x)= g(x)q(x),则适当调整系数后,可使f(x)的因式g(x)、q(x)也为整系数多项式。对于整数a,等式f(a)= g(a)q(a)中的g(a)的数值必为f(a)的因数,数学论文由于f(a)的因数是有限个,所以只能得到有限个g(a);设f(x)有k次因式g(x),f(x)在某k+1个点x0、x1、…、xk处的值分别为f(x0)、f(x1)、…、f(xk),再对f(xi)(其中i=0,1,…,k)进行因式分解,所得的因数个数为pi(其中i=0,1,…,k),从f(xi)的因数集中取一个因数,一共有牛顿插值算法在因式分解中的设计与实现-论文网种不同的方法,利用拉格朗日插值公式求出多项式g(x),判定所求多项式g(x)是否为f(x)的因式。
在因式分解中涉及多项式的整除性,本文利用多项式整除性的一些性质,对多项式可能存在的因式进行判断,找出多项式的因式。一般情况下,人工可以进行4次及一下的多项式的分解,而高于4次的多项式很难进行分解,于是设想用计算机来解决这个问题,把高次多项式分解成一些不可约多项式的积,提高解题效率。
1 算法原理分析
1.1 Newton向前差分插值算法
在Kronecker提供的因式分解构造性算法中,采用了朗格朗日插值算法。拉格朗日插值算法虽格式整齐和规范,但计算量大、没有承袭性,当需要增加差值节点时,不得不重新计算所有插值基函数,同时内存消耗大[5]。且有时会产生切断误差而不能进行精确因式分解。于是本文用牛顿向前差分差值算法[6]代替拉格朗日算法。

儿歌故事

《问刘十九》

绿蚁新醅酒,红泥小火炉。晚来天欲雪,能饮一杯无!

《精灵的谷子》

冬天的早晨,精灵踏着地面冰块,随着“吱吱”的声音,走出家门,顿时,被一阵刺骨的北风刮得浑身发抖,“这个鬼天气真是要命,我也不想出门晨练了,在家睡觉多好,嘻嘻!”他说完,还是硬着头皮

《少年心中国梦》

我为中华崛起而读书,我为祖国富强而刻苦,少年心装着中国梦,我们踏上复兴之路,为了明天强大的国度,为了屹立世界的民族,少年的梦想开始加速,五彩阳光洒满幸福,啊中国梦,中国中国在我心

育儿知识

家教中扼杀聪明宝宝的10宗罪

天下的父母都爱孩子,但如果爱的不得法,反而会影响孩子的一生,孩子天生纯真的品性也会一步步受到伤害。

儿童做家务年龄对照表,舍不得用孩子才害了他!

出于疼爱,很多父母不舍得让孩子干一点家务活。有的妈妈还认为,做家务是大人的事情,孩子好好读书就好了。可孩子不做家务专心学习,就会更优秀么?

这8大育儿困扰,你家或多或少都有!怎么破,专家来支招!

每一个孩子都有自己独特的个性,因材施教绝对不是一句空话。

家园共育

【优秀亲子活动展示】中班集锦《狐狸和葡萄》

《狐狸和葡萄》秋天是水果收获的季节,摘一筐鲜水果,感受丰收的喜悦,是秋日最美好的体验。瞧,葡萄也成熟了,紫莹莹的、圆溜溜的,一串一串挂在枝头摇曳,看上去真诱人。可是,狐狸偏要说

【优秀亲子活动展示】大班集锦《谷粒声声》

秋天的脚步逐渐走远,忙碌的收获季也暂告一段落,在农民伯伯乐呵呵的笑声中我们迎来了冬爷爷,他带着寒风和雪花来报到了,在这样一个秋冬之交的时节里,增强孩子的抵抗力,保持孩子的健

【优秀亲子活动展示】小班集锦《出汗行动》

随着季节的更替,人体最直接的变化是汗珠不见了。汗珠从哪儿来?汗珠又去哪儿了呢?爸爸可以带着孩子来一次出汗行动:一起晨跑运动锻炼身体;一起打扫卫生做做家务;一起在社区当志愿者